Hello!

How many tests functions does Excel authorizes in one formula?
for instance:

=IF(...;...; IF(...;...IF(...,... IF(...;...; .... ))))

I went up to 8, then I get an error message asking me to check the
parentheses the punctuation.. even if it's correct.

Thanks for any suggestion!
 
You are limited to 7 levels of nested functions. Perhaps you can
use VLOOKUP or CHOOSE instead of a series of IFs.

and I also can separate the forumla in 2 cells by putting in the last ELSE
clause to look in another cell that contains more ifs

Thanks for the hint! it helps
 
Yes you could do that. You might need to watch the order in which you
arrange the two cells.
